Hello,

Since few days, I always have duplicated files when copying then renaming.

For example :
1) I copy myfile.docx, a file is created named "myfile - copy.docx"

2) Then, If I rename this copy to "myfile2.docx", and open it...
when closing, I find two files named "myfile - copy.docx" and "myfile2.docx".

My files are in a Sharepoint library, synchronized.

The problem doesn't occur when using Windows File Explorer. My default file explorer is XYplorer.
